*sine continuous sound power (both channels operated)
+
[[Kategorie:Vollverstärker]]
**at 1 kHz 4 Ohm 2x35W
 
at 20-20.000 Hz8 Ohm 2x25W
 
*Distortion factor 0.3
 
*Intermodulation 0,2%
 
*power bandwidth 20-40,000 Hz
 
*Frequency response 20-20,000 Hz
 
*Silence margin
 
phono 75 dB
 
AUX 90 dB
 
*Input sensitivity (impedance)
 
phono 2.5 µV/45 kOhm
 
AUX , Tape I, Tape II 140 µV/50 kOhm
 
*Tone control
 
Bass, ± 8 dB/100 Hz
 
treble, ± 8 dB/10 kHz
 
*Output level/impedance
 
*Phono, AUX, Tuner 140 mV
 
*General data
 
**Power supply 120 V 220 V. 240 V 50/60 Hz
 
**Power consumption 180 W
 
**Dimensions (W x H x D) 390 x 143 x 330 rnm
 
**Weight 7.8 kg
 
**Black and silver finish
